Tour Highlights:

Bodrum Castle (St. Peter’s Castle)
Step inside one of the most well-preserved medieval castles on the Aegean. Built in the 15th century by the Knights of St. John, the castle boasts towers named after European nations and sweeping sea views.
Duration: 1 hour • Admission Ticket Not Included

Bodrum Museum of Underwater Archaeology
Located within the castle, this world-renowned museum showcases shipwrecks, ancient amphorae, jewelry, and maritime relics. Don't miss the Uluburun Shipwreck, one of the oldest ever discovered.
Duration: 30 minutes • Admission Ticket Not Included

Myndos Gate
Part of the ancient city walls of Halicarnassus, this site once witnessed the march of Alexander the Great. Explore the remains of defensive structures and ancient tombs.
Duration: 30 minutes • Free Admission

Bodrum Windmills
A picturesque stop with panoramic views of Bodrum and the Aegean, especially breathtaking at sunset. Learn about their 18th-century origins.
Duration: 30 minutes • Free Admission

Bodrum Amphitheater
Built in the 4th century BC under King Mausolus, this ancient Hellenistic theatre once held up to 13,000 spectators. Still in use today, it offers panoramic views of the coastline.
